[0046] The block diagram of the frequency conversion electromagnetic prospecting system with automatic synchronization of transmission and reception is as follows: figure 1 shown. The survey system applying the method of the present invention mainly includes a transmitter and a receiver. The transmitter feeds a current signal of a certain frequency and magnitude to the earth through the sending electrode, as an artificial excitation source, and the frequency of the sent current signal is automatically switched according to the preset "time-frequency table". The receiver receives the magnetotelluric response synchronously according to the same "time-frequency table" as the transmitter, and filters out the noise through the correlation detection method to obtain the magnetotelluric response containing the ground resistivity information with a hi...
